We have studied the densities of states of the series of alloys FeAl,
CoAl, and NiAl, each in the disordered state, using the augmented-spac
e recursion technique coupled with the tight-binding muffin-tin orbita
ls method. We have estimated the local moments in these alloys using t
he spin-polarized version of the tight-binding linearized muffin-tin o
rbitals method. We have also obtained the effective pair interactions
for these alloys.
